Skip to content
  • weinig@apple.com's avatar
    WebCore: · 81ed4494
    weinig@apple.com authored
    2008-04-17  Sam Weinig  <sam@webkit.org>
    
            Reviewed by Anders Carlsson.
    
            Autogenerate the XMLHttpRequest javascript binding.
    
            * GNUmakefile.am:
            * WebCore.pro:
            * WebCore.vcproj/WebCore.vcproj:
            * WebCoreSources.bkl:
            * DerivedSources.make:
            * WebCore.xcodeproj/project.pbxproj:
            * bindings/js/JSDOMWindowBase.cpp:
            * bindings/js/JSXMLHttpRequest.cpp: Removed.
            * bindings/js/JSXMLHttpRequest.h: Removed.
            * bindings/js/JSXMLHttpRequestConstructor.cpp: Added.
            (WebCore::JSXMLHttpRequestConstructor::JSXMLHttpRequestConstructor):
            (WebCore::JSXMLHttpRequestConstructor::implementsConstruct):
            (WebCore::JSXMLHttpRequestConstructor::construct):
            * bindings/js/JSXMLHttpRequestConstructor.h: Added.
            (WebCore::JSXMLHttpRequestConstructor::classInfo):
            * bindings/js/JSXMLHttpRequestCustom.cpp: Added.
            (WebCore::JSXMLHttpRequest::mark):
            (WebCore::JSXMLHttpRequest::onreadystatechange):
            (WebCore::JSXMLHttpRequest::setOnreadystatechange):
            (WebCore::JSXMLHttpRequest::onload):
            (WebCore::JSXMLHttpRequest::setOnload):
            (WebCore::JSXMLHttpRequest::responseXML):
            (WebCore::JSXMLHttpRequest::open):
            (WebCore::JSXMLHttpRequest::setRequestHeader):
            (WebCore::JSXMLHttpRequest::send):
            (WebCore::JSXMLHttpRequest::getResponseHeader):
            (WebCore::JSXMLHttpRequest::overrideMimeType):
            (WebCore::JSXMLHttpRequest::addEventListener):
            (WebCore::JSXMLHttpRequest::removeEventListener):
            (WebCore::JSXMLHttpRequest::dispatchEvent):
            * xml/XMLHttpRequest.cpp:
            (WebCore::XMLHttpRequest::readyState):
            (WebCore::XMLHttpRequest::responseText):
            * xml/XMLHttpRequest.h:
            * xml/XMLHttpRequest.idl: Added.
    
    LayoutTests:
    
    2008-04-17  Sam Weinig  <sam@webkit.org>
    
            Reviewed by Anders Carlsson.
    
            Update test result for additon of XMLHttpRequest constants.
    
            * fast/dom/Window/window-properties-expected.txt:
    
    
    git-svn-id: http://svn.webkit.org/repository/webkit/trunk@32037 268f45cc-cd09-0410-ab3c-d52691b4dbfc
    81ed4494